Output 47b7531022f1fb0eea4aa75a5ffb234a18ef1457440804c0a1830645ac177bc0:0

value
84600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c6721e6fe9fecec444c64a21ba6dbb2d765384a OP_EQUAL
address
3EVQ5AdqVeUb5qHV6f86mWBsHJqFkQ2fa5
transaction
47b7531022f1fb0eea4aa75a5ffb234a18ef1457440804c0a1830645ac177bc0
spent
true